Company awards first place winners of 12 hour race

Kuwait, 15 March 2015:

Zain, the leading telecommunications company in Kuwait, announced today its main sponsorship of the recently held GulfRun Karting Endurance Race. The event was held last weekend at SIRBB Circuit with overwhelming participation of motorsport enthusiasts.

Zain's continuous support to GulfRun is in line with the company's utmost Corporate Social Responsibility towards youth talents development and the sports sector. The company will spare no efforts in supporting causes and initiatives that spread awareness on certain areas that concern the next generation, especially that this exciting race was established by a group of Kuwaiti youth. 

Zain took part in the exciting event that was held throughout 12 continuous hours, and witnessed immense participation of motorsport enthusiast in Kuwait. The company awarded first place winning teams, further confirming its commitment towards the encouragement of youth's abilities and achievements.

The Karting Endurance race is increasingly attracting more motorsport enthusiast in Kuwait. Participants competed by driving specialized Karts at SIRBB Circuit over a straight period of 12 hours with tremendous success gathering many enthusiasts of this sport.  

GulfRun is considered an ideal and safe alternative to street racing which threatens youth's lives. Motorsport enthusiasts can showcase their talents within professional and certified circuits while gaining professional guidance based on worldwide safety procedures. Zain's sponsorship came in light of the current passion arousing within youth for car racing, and by sponsoring this event; the company is highlighting its dedication to applying safety measures while driving within Kuwaiti youth

It is worth mentioning that GulfRun is an annual motorsport event which was established in 2005 by a group of Kuwaiti youth who are simply passionate about automobile racing. The race extinguishes itself from any other motorsport race by promoting a safe and secure environment to race and train, as well as spreading awareness to limit street accidents.
